Envision Solar Introduces Mobile Electric Vehicle Charging Station

Envision-Solar
Envision Solar International, Inc., a sustainable infrastructure product designer and developer, has completed the engineering and fabrication of the EV ARC, world’s first fully autonomous, fully mobile, fully renewable Electric Vehicle Charging station.

The EV ARC is easy-to-install, standalone solar charging station that requires no foundation, no trenching, no building permit and no grid connection.

Designed to fit inside one standard parking space the EV ARC does not reduce available parking because vehicles park on its ballasted pad. EV ARC is ADA compliant and will offer EV Charging day or night through the use of on board battery storage. The EV ARC is delivered to the customer site ready to operate and requires no installation work.

Invented, engineered and fabricated in the United States, the EV ARC fits inside a standard parking space and generates approximately 16 kWhrs per day that are stored and ready for use in the 22 kWhr on board battery storage. The system’s clean solar electrical generation is enhanced by EnvisionTrak which enables the solar array to follow the sun, generating 18 to 25 percent more electricity than a conventional fixed array.

The EV ARC is ready to ship to customers.

The past year has seen a major uptick in deployments of electric vehicle supply equipment (EVSE).  This acceleration is a direct result of developments in the market for plug-in electric vehicles. The EVSE market is expected to expand steadily as well.  Unit sales of EVSE will rise from under 200,000 in 2012 to 3.8 million in 2020, with 11.4 million EV charging stations to be in operation worldwide by 2020.
